Donald Trump’s disgraced former lawyer Michael Cohen is looking for a television show that could allow him to cash in on the renewed publicity sparked by the candidate’s legal woes.

The show would be called “The Fixer” — a reference to Cohen’s time working as Trump’s bare-knuckle lawyer and an imitation of Trump’s turn in “The Apprentice” — and would involve Cohen being put in business and in other scenarios so he can “fix it”. “them,” insiders told the Post.

Cohen confirmed the show’s premise and told the Post that the ideas were still “at a very early stage.”

“Someone came up with the idea for the concept and we shot a three-minute teaser for it.” Cohen said.

Cohen said he was working with Colin Whelan of Conveyor Media, whose past credits include “Joe Exotic: Tigers, Lies and Cover-Up” for Investigation Discovery; “Cooking On High” for Netflix; and “Bargain Mansions” for HGTV.

“He’s part of that whole shopping team,” Cohen said of Whelan.

Reached by phone, Whelan refuted: “We don’t really all work together anymore. »

Cohen — who was sentenced to three years in federal prison in 2018 after pleading guilty to charges of campaign finance fraud and tax evasion — is set to play a star role in Trump’s ongoing trial in Manhattan.

Cohen played a key role in alleged secret payments to porn star Stormy Daniels during the 2016 presidential campaign to silence her about an affair with Trump, authorities said.

The former president has always denied the affair and any wrongdoing.
